Job description

Based at Linden House in Lymington, Hampshire

From £14.00 up to £15.50 per hour

Full-time 42 hrs per week position, with flexibility required (includes paid breaks)

At Colten Care we are proud to offer career development opportunities, and a range of pay enhancements across our roles. Contact us to find out more

We're searching for an experienced, passionate and well‑rounded Commis Chef to join our team and become a valued part of day‑to‑day life. Access to your own vehicle is essential for this role.

Main Responsibilities
  • Assist the Head Chef to prepare a variety of home‑cooked meals including a selection of fresh cakes from local produce
  • Provide tasty nutritionally balanced meals across the various mealtimes
  • Work closely with staff to support catering for specific dietary needs and special events
  • Provide team support, assisting with the training and development of new starters and covering the Kitchen Assistant when required
  • Ensure a safe, hygienic working environment by following Health and Safety and Food Hygiene regulations

About Colten Care

We’re an award‑winning, family‑owned, independent care home group, with an outstanding reputation in the industry. This is due to our amazing people and our focus on keeping the resident at the heart of everything we do.

We strive to be the best we can hence why all 21 of our nursing homes are rated at least good and 7 are outstanding by the CQC, our national regulator.
